The distance between Beira to Mbombela via Vilankulos is 1350 Km by road. You can also find the distance from Beira to Mbombela via Vilankulos using other travel options like bus, subway, tram, train and rail. Apart from the trip distance, refer
Directions from Beira to Mbombela via Vilankulos for road driving directions!